Careers

Our Current Positions

  • Departments

Project and Documentation Specialist

Burnaby Branch
Full-time

Our Burnaby team is looking for a Project and Documentation Specialist to support our Commercial Sales Department! This role will work closely with our Commercial Team to input and monitor data for our projects; as well as ensure customer satisfaction by providing updates and respond to inquiries. Additionally, this role will collaborate with our Sales Coordinator to assist with ongoing branch projects, making this role an essential part of our team’s operations.

Apply Now

Residential Territory Manager

Victoria Branch
Full-time

We are currently seeking a talented Residential Territory Manager to join our team in Victoria. In this role, you will be responsible for supporting sales growth and profit with our existing customer base, while implementing strategies for diversification within the Residential New Construction and Retrofit Markets.

Apply Now

Outside Sales Representative

Regina Branch
Full-time

Join ECCO Supply as an Outside Sales Representative and become a key player in our dynamic team! You’ll engage with customers through various channels, champion exceptional service, and drive HVAC business growth. If you’re passionate about sales, have technical know-how, and HVAC expertise, we want to hear from you.

Apply Now

Purchaser

Corporate Operations – Langley, BC
Full-time

We are actively seeking two Purchasers to join our team, each specializing in a specific region: One in British Columbia and one in Alberta. The Purchasers will play a pivotal role in overseeing and managing pricing, monitoring cost fluctuations, addressing discrepancies, and handling the procurement of raw materials within their respective areas. Additionally, they will be tasked with cultivating and maintaining strong relationships with vendors skillfully negotiating contracts, and preparing comprehensive reports.

Apply Now

Business System Analyst

Corporate Administration – Edmonton, AB
Full Time

The Business Systems Analyst will be a liaison between Business Units and IT team members. As a primary point of contact, the BSA will be responsible for documenting Business requirements, planning, executing, providing guidance, and any other related tasks to ultimately deliver upon IT initiatives. This role will also provide front line support for any enhancements within various applications systems.

Apply Now

Inside Sales Representative

Red Deer Branch

The Inside Sales Representative will help us drive sales growth while delivering top-notch customer service. This role will collaborate with our Branch Manager, Outside Sales Team, and Warehouse personnel to exceed sales targets and expand our customer base.

Apply Now